Closing at the Mod Club tonight are headliners Five Blank Pages, who are celebrating the release of their new EP, "Young Glow." Paradoxically, it's also the band's final show. Ever. (His wife, keyboardist Pinar Ozyetis, is 8 months pregnant with their first child.) It's a shame, given their big, melodic sound, enhanced by cello, violin, even the occasional trombone. "We just wanted to leave you with something to remember," says lead singer Noyan Hilmi, who can be forgiven for sounding a bit moody. (More pics below.)
